Sun to help AMD with Opteron development?

Posted on Sunday, July 24 2005 @ 10:17 CEST by Thomas De Maesschalck
After canceling Sparc-related projects, Sun says it will help AMD to design the Opteron server processor. AMD hasn't confirmed this yet but in the past the company used quite a number of technologies that were developed by or co-developed with other companies.

In case Sun helps the development of the chip, the final server product may receive some very tangible upgrade over the current generation, as Sun has a lot of technology expertise in the development of server processors. It remains to be seen whether AMD desktop processors also implement Sun’s technologies.
